Grid for ipad - 50% off!

Between 1st - 11th April, Smartbox are offering Grid for iPad with 50% discount to celebrate Autism Awareness Month.

Working as we do with Assistive Technology on a daily basis, we perhaps take for granted that the clients we support have access to the solutions they require, be that for communication, environmental control or access to their school work. It is important that we reflect that there are many people for whom such solutions are out of reach through no fault of their own and that we have a duty as professionals in this industry to highlight opportunities for as many people as possible to gain access to the products and services that they need.

Grid is such a fantastic solution to augment communication and we have seen huge success with our wonderful clients in their use of Grid for iPad in schools and out in the community. Being able to access communication on a device that many have access to for other means already is such a valuable commodity, here's hoping that by sharing this offer, someone is able to begin their AAC journey a little sooner than they thought.
